How can companies effectively measure the ROI of their customer experience training programs and use this data to make informed decisions on future training investments and improvements?

Companies can effectively measure the ROI of their customer experience training programs by tracking key performance indicators such as customer satisfaction scores, customer retention rates, and employee engagement levels before and after the training. They can also conduct surveys or focus groups to gather direct feedback from employees and customers on the impact of the training. By analyzing this data, companies can identify areas of improvement and make informed decisions on future training investments, such as adjusting the content or delivery method to better meet the needs of their employees and customers. Additionally, companies can use this data to track the overall effectiveness of their training programs over time and make adjustments as needed to ensure they are continuously improving the customer experience.
